      <Title>Software Verification &amp; Validation Engineer (OBC)</Title>
      <Description><![CDATA[<p>We are entering an expansive phase and have several exciting assignments and projects coming up within the area of Verification &amp; Validation of Onboard Chargers (OBC). As a Software Engineer in V&amp;V for OBC, you will have the opportunity to work across a broad technical scope, be part of advanced development environments, and contribute to ensuring that our customers receive safe and high-performance charging systems.</p>
<p>In this role, you will work broadly with verification and validation of Onboard Chargers (OBC) within various customer projects. You will be an important part of our technical deliveries and work closely with both internal teams and external partners to ensure that our solutions meet the highest quality standards.</p>
<p>The work covers the entire chain of test and validation activities – from requirement review and breakdown into test plans, to the execution of functional tests, system tests, and various environmental and climate validations. You will work both in lab environments, climate chambers, and in the field, contributing to the development of test methods, test environments, and automated tests.</p>
<p>A central part of the role is analysing test results, identifying deviations and improvement opportunities, and compiling reports to present your recommendations to both technical teams and project organisations. You will collaborate cross-functionally with several areas of expertise, often taking on a coordinating role in many of the assignments.</p>

      <Title>SEIT Lead (Omen - UAE)</Title>
      <Description><![CDATA[<p>We are seeking a SEIT Lead to join the Omen team based in Abu Dhabi, UAE. As the world enters an era of strategic competition, Anduril is committed to bringing cutting-edge autonomy, AI, computer vision, sensor fusion, and networking technology to the military in months, not years.</p>
<p>You will work on a new aircraft development project, bringing pragmatic SEIT thinking to deeply understand local requirements and champion &#39;Test&#39; as a design tool to drive rapid capability development, ensuring that end-user needs are met in challenging operational environments.</p>
<p>Key Responsibilities:</p>
<ul>
<li>Work with customers and end-users to evolve the regional Concept of Operations (CONOPS) the product life cycle, developing inputs to high-level requirements informing key design decisions.</li>
</ul>
<ul>
<li>Deploy right-sized, Agile Systems Engineering governance approaches for rapid capability development efforts - with the right amount of process discipline and artifacts and support System Design Reviews (SDRs).</li>
</ul>
<ul>
<li>Manage System Interfaces and develop integration processes for sovereign Mission System equipment and Payloads, developing test objectives and test plans for execution.</li>
</ul>
<ul>
<li>Work with partner organisations to coordinate a broad range of in-country development activities including bench and environmental testing of individual components, building and operating Hardware In Lab (HIL)/Hardware In The Loop (HITL) integration environments, flight testing of uncrewed and crewed surrogate platforms, and ground and flight test of the Omen System.</li>
</ul>
<ul>
<li>Liaise with partner organisations and local authorities to secure operational approvals (airspace, frequency, physical deconfliction, safety, and appropriate test range facilities).</li>
</ul>
<ul>
<li>Shape, build and utilise Anduril in-country development facilities establishing local capability.</li>
</ul>
<ul>
<li>Plan, coordinate and execute major test and demonstration events, including resourcing, logistics (equipment export/import), conduct Test Readiness Reviews (TRRs), perform as Test Director (TD), and ensure high-impact, timely reporting.</li>
</ul>
<ul>
<li>Conduct safety assessments with a pragmatic understanding of hazards and mitigations - holding the safety of team members above all else.</li>

      <Title>Staff Engineer, Flight Control - X-BAT</Title>
      <Description><![CDATA[<p>In this role, you will contribute to the flight control system for XBAT, with responsibility for delivering stable, predictable, and operationally robust performance across all phases of flight.</p>
<p>Key responsibilities include:</p>
<ul>
<li>Design and implement flight control laws and supporting logic across multiple flight regimes.</li>
<li>Build and mature high-fidelity 6DOF simulation environments used for control development and ensure accurate pre-flight performance predictions.</li>
<li>Execute verification activities, including linear analysis, Monte Carlo campaigns, disturbance/sensitivity/degraded operation testing, and HIL validation.</li>
<li>Diagnose and resolve simulation-to-test mismatches, including unidentified dynamics and modeling gaps.</li>
<li>Support flight test operations and contribute to rapid iteration between flights.</li>
<li>Work closely with propulsion, aero, actuation, sensors, state estimation, and autonomy teams to ensure accurate integrated system performance in the 6DOF simulation environment.</li>

      <Title>R&amp;D Engineering, Sr Engineer ( C++, RTL, Verilog)</Title>
      <Description><![CDATA[<p>Synopsys software engineers are key enablers in the world of Electronic Design Automation (EDA), developing and maintaining software used in chip design, verification and manufacturing. They work on assignments like designing, developing, and troubleshooting software, leveraging the state-of-the-art technologies like AI/ML, GenAI and Cloud. Their critical contributions enable world-wide EDA designers to extend the frontiers of semiconductors and chip development.</p>
<p>As a Senior Engineer in the R&amp;D department, you will be responsible for developing and deploying emulation models for Zebu, focusing on bus protocols like PCIe, USB, CSI, and DSI. You will implement designs in C++, RTL, and SystemVerilog-DPIs, and collaborate with cross-functional teams to ensure seamless SoC bring-up and software development in pre-silicon environments. You will also create and optimize use models and applications for various emulation projects, conduct thorough verification and validation processes to ensure the highest quality of emulation models, and provide technical guidance and mentorship to junior team members when necessary.</p>
